
Former Ghana captain John Mensah has urged the Black Stars to stay united ahead of their crucial World Cup qualifiers.
He believes the current squad has shown strong promise and only needs a few additions to reach its goals.
“This is the team they are maintaining for them to stay for the national team but I believe if they keep on and a little changes I think they can also be together and work hard for the nation. At the end you can see that they can achieve the trophy for the nation so I think they should maintain them," he told Peace FM.
"Sometimes the coach can see some of the players performing well for their clubs so any coach can call up any other player to come and join. But the only thing is that they should maintain what they have and little that they brought in I think it can be better for them,”
Ghana currently tops Group I with 15 points after five wins in six games. The Black Stars play Chad in N’Djamena on September 4 before hosting Mali in Accra four days later.
